vue 使当前页面重新加载,区别于window.location.reload,用户体验更好一下, 使用了 s-Table组件 > 基础的使用方式与 API 与 [官方版(Table)](https://vuecomponent.github.io/ant-design-vue ...
业务场景:在管理后台,在执行完,增,删,改,操作的时候。我们需要刷新一下页面,重载数据。在JQ中我们会用到location.reload 方法,刷新页面 在vue中,这里需要用到一个provide inject这对用例。 其他方法:this. router.go ,会强制刷新,出现空白页面体验不好 这对选项需要一起使用,以允许一个祖先组件向其所有子孙后代注入一个依赖,不论组件层次有多深,并在起上下 ...
2019-04-02 13:49 4 16949 推荐指数:
vue 使当前页面重新加载,区别于window.location.reload,用户体验更好一下, 使用了 s-Table组件 > 基础的使用方式与 API 与 [官方版(Table)](https://vuecomponent.github.io/ant-design-vue ...
业务场景:在管理后台,在执行完,增,删,改,操作的时候。我们需要刷新一下页面,重载数据。在JQ中我们会用到location.reload()方法,刷新页面;在vue中,这里需要用到一个 provide / inject 这对用例。(其他方法:this.$router.go(0),会强制刷新,出现 ...
第一种方法:provide / inject声明注入法(通过在app.vue声明reload方法,控制router-view的显示或隐藏状态来实现) 在需要刷新的页面注入reload方法 第二种方法:强制刷新(不太友好,建议使用第一种方法)location. ...
1.场景 在处理列表是,常常有删除一条数据或者新增一条数据之后需要重新刷新当前页面的需求。 2.遇到的问题 (1)用vue-router重新路由到当前页面,页面是不进行刷新的 (2)采用window.reload( ), 或者router.go(0) 刷新时,整个浏览器进行了重新加载 ...
https://www.jianshu.com/p/5f9db6b8914b 有时候在项目中我们需要在页面完成一些操作后,进行页面刷新.文中重点介绍provide / inject组合是vue2.2.0新增的api 解决方案以及出现的问题 1.this.$router.go ...
Vue. 之 刷新当前页面,重载页面数据 如下截图,点击左侧不同的数据,右侧根据左侧的KEY动态加载数据。由于右侧是同一个页面,在进行路由跳转后,不会再次刷新数据。 解决方案: 右侧的页面中 script代码块添加:watch模块,如下代码: ...
一、this.$router.go(0) 相当于F5刷新,这种方法虽然代码很少,只有一行,但是体验很差。页面会一瞬间的白屏,体验不是很好 二、location.reload() 这种也是一样,画面一闪,体验不是很好,相当于页面刷新 推荐解决方法: 三、用provide / inject ...